Resin composition

To provide a resin composition comprising an aromatic polycarbonate resin and having excellent appearance, impact strength, thermal stability, hydrolysis resistance, and flame retardancy.The present invention relates to a resin composition comprising (A) 75 to 99.98 wt % of an aromatic polycarbonate resin (component A), (B) 0.01 to 5 wt % of a mixture of polytetrafluoroethylene particles and an organic polymer (component B) and (C) 0.01 to 20 wt % of a flame retardant (component C), wherein the sodium metal ion content of the component B (excluding sodium metal ion contained in the polytetrafluoroethylene particles) is 10 ppm or less, and molded articles therefrom.

Pregabalin sustained release composition and method for preparing the same

The present application relates to a pregabalin sustained release composition, comprising: (a) an active ingredient; (b) a matrix-forming agent; (c) a swelling agent; (d) a gelling agent; and optionally a filler. The pregabalin sustained release composition provided in the present application can rapidly swell in volume when exposed to aqueous medium until exceeding the diameter of human gastric pyloric (13 mm). It thereby prolongs the gastric emptying time to increase the retention time of pregabalin in the stomach and enhances absorption of pregabalin in the small intestine and ascending colon. Moreover, the pregabalin sustained release composition provided herein achieves a sustained release for 24 h, which allows QD (once a day) administration, reduces administration number, and improves patient compliance.

Battery case

The invention is directed to a battery case (1) comprising a compartment (2) for at least one battery module (3). Two first outer beams (4) extending in a first spatial direction (x) and two second outer beams (5) extending in a second spatial direction (y) are arranged essentially perpendicular to the first spatial direction. The first and second beams (4, 5) are forming a frame-like support structure (6). A tub-shaped insert (7) is connected to the grid like support structure (6) from a third direction (z) arranged essentially perpendicular to the first and the second direction (x, y). A closure (8) closes the tub-shaped insert (7) to form the closed compartment (2) for the at least one battery module.
